如何记录浏览网站的用户

时间:2011-12-28 07:57:11

标签: c# asp.net asp.net-mvc

我想记录浏览到我网站的所有用户,以便存储IP地址。我已经记录了登录我网站的用户,但对于没有登录的用户,我真的不知道如何

2 个答案:

答案 0 :(得分:1)

您可以使用第三方分析工具,例如Google Analytics。或者您可以根据本文[How to get a user's client IP address in ASP.NET?]获取客户​​端的IP地址,并将其存储在数据库中。

答案 1 :(得分:0)

您可以在Global.asax.cs的“Session_Start”中记录IP地址和浏览器信息,每次启动新用户会话时都会触发该信息。如果用户已登录,则可以跳过日志。